    The Vibe

    Gran Hotel Inglés presents an understated, historically rooted presence on a narrow Calle de Echegaray in Madrid’s Barrio de las Letras. The property leans into its 1886 origins without theatrical nostalgia, occupying its cultural weight with restraint. Tile-fronted bars, shuttered windows and a street that asks pedestrians to make room all contribute to an intimate, charming atmosphere; the hotel’s facade is modest enough that passersby can miss it altogether. Inside and out, the mood is quietly refined—an approachable, tucked-away address that balances period provenance with careful contemporary stewardship.

    Hotel context

    How it compares in Madrid

    Four Seasons Hotel Madrid is the better pick for travelers who want the largest-feeling luxury experience and are comfortable paying for scale. Gran Hotel Inglés is the sharper choice for a smaller, more contained Centro stay where the room and address matter more than a full grand-hotel ecosystem.

    JW Marriott Hotel Madrid suits guests who prefer a familiar international luxury brand rhythm. Hotel Urban Madrid is the stronger cross-shop for a more design-forward mood. Gran Hotel Inglés lands between them: formal enough for a serious trip, less corporate than the JW Marriott, less scene-driven than Hotel Urban.

    For value-sensitive central stays, compare it with Catalonia Las Cortes and Hotel Villa Real 5*. Those can make sense when rate discipline matters more than awards depth. Choose Gran Hotel Inglés when external recognition, boutique scale, a central Madrid address justify the premium.
